Can LASIK fix myopia?

I have myopia and want to fix it. Can LASIK fix myopia?

2 Answers

Yes, LASIK fixes myopia and astigmatism. Of course, there are exceptions to every rule. Your LASIK surgeon will do pre-op testing to make sure you are a good candidate
Yes, LASIK can fix myopia by altering the shape of the front of the eye with a laser. However, there are limits on how high a prescription can be treated. Your cornea has to be measured carefully after the surgery to avoid a bulging condition called corneal ectasia. Most surgeons recommend waiting until the age of 21 and require at least one year of a stable prescription.
